    MAN OVERBOARD FROM F/V MATSU MARU VICINITY 37-25N 159-46E
    AT 211000Z SEP. VESSELS IN VICINITY REQUESTED TO KEEP A
    SHARP LOOKOUT, ASSIST IF POSSIBLE. REPORTS TO JAPAN COAST GUARD.
